Ordinance - 681ORDINANCE NO. 681 A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F WEST COVINA AMENDING CERTAIN OF THE ZONING PROVISIONS. OF THE WEST COVINA MUNICIPAL CODE RELATING TO PARKING REQUIREMENTS. The City Council of the City of West Covina does ordain as •follows: SECTION 1. The City Council does hereby find, determine and declare that the following amendments were duly initiated, that notice of hearing thereon was duly given and published, that public hearings thereon were duly held by the Planning Commission and City Council, and that the public convenience and necessity and the general welfare require that the following changes and amendments be made. SECTION 2. -Sections 9207.10, 9208.10, 9210.7 and 9219.14- are hereby amended to read respectively as follows: "9207.10. SAME. OFF-STREET PARKING. The provisions of Part 19 of this Chapter, providing for and regulating off-street parking, shall apply to Zone R-3a. 9208.10. SAME. OFF-STREET PARKING. The provisions of Part 19 of this Chapter, providing for and regulating off-street parking, shall apply to Zone R-3b. 9210.7. SAME. OFF-STREET PARKING. The off-street parking spaces required shall be not less than those set forth in Part 19 of this Chapter. 9219.14. SAME. PARKING SPACES REQUIRED. The number of off-street parking spaces required shall be no less than as set forth in the following: USE PARKING SPACE REQUIRED Single Family 1 per dwelling unit Two Family 1 per dwelling unit Multiple Family: In Zone R-3.or R-P l.per dwelling unit In Zone R-3a 1-1/4 per dwelling unit (a) One off-street parking space, enclosed on three sides and roof, shall be provided for each dwelling unit and located within three hundred feet thereof. (b) In addition to the above requirement one off-street parking space for each four units or fraction thereof shall be provided, which need not be enclosed, and shall be located within five hundred feet thereof. In Zone R-3b 1-3/4 per dwelling unit (a) One and one -quarter off-street parking space enclosed on three sides and roof, shall be provided for each dwelling unit • and located within three hundred feet thereof. Any fractional parking space required shall be increased to a full parking space. (b) In addition to the above requirement, one off-street parking space for each two dwellings or fraction thereof shall be provided, which need not be enclosed, and shall be located within five hundred feet thereof.
